/* General purpose matching subroutine.  The target string is a
   scanf-like format string in which spaces correspond to arbitrary
   whitespace (including no whitespace), characters correspond to
   themselves.  The %-codes are:
 
   %%  Literal percent sign
   %e  Expression, pointer to a pointer is set
   %s  Symbol, pointer to the symbol is set
   %n  Name, character buffer is set to name
   %t  Matches end of statement.
   %o  Matches an intrinsic operator, returned as an INTRINSIC enum.
   %l  Matches a statement label
   %v  Matches a variable expression (an lvalue)
   %   Matches a required space (in free form) and optional spaces.  */
 
match
gfc_match (const char *target, ...)
{
  gfc_st_label **label;
  int matches, *ip;
  locus old_loc;
  va_list argp;
  char c, *np;
  match m, n;
  void **vp;
  const char *p;
 
  old_loc = gfc_current_locus;
  va_start (argp, target);
  m = MATCH_NO;
  matches = 0;
  p = target;
 
loop:
  c = *p++;
  switch (c)
    {
    case ' ':
      gfc_gobble_whitespace ();
      goto loop;
    case '\0':
      m = MATCH_YES;
      break;
 
    case '%':
      c = *p++;
      switch (c)
	{
	case 'e':
	  vp = va_arg (argp, void **);
	  n = gfc_match_expr ((gfc_expr **) vp);
	  if (n != MATCH_YES)
	    {
	      m = n;
	      goto not_yes;
	    }
 
	  matches++;
	  goto loop;
 
	case 'v':
	  vp = va_arg (argp, void **);
	  n = gfc_match_variable ((gfc_expr **) vp, 0);
	  if (n != MATCH_YES)
	    {
	      m = n;
	      goto not_yes;
	    }
 
	  matches++;
	  goto loop;
 
	case 's':
	  vp = va_arg (argp, void **);
	  n = gfc_match_symbol ((gfc_symbol **) vp, 0);
	  if (n != MATCH_YES)
	    {
	      m = n;
	      goto not_yes;
	    }
 
	  matches++;
	  goto loop;
 
	case 'n':
	  np = va_arg (argp, char *);
	  n = gfc_match_name (np);
	  if (n != MATCH_YES)
	    {
	      m = n;
	      goto not_yes;
	    }
 
	  matches++;
	  goto loop;
 
	case 'l':
	  label = va_arg (argp, gfc_st_label **);
	  n = gfc_match_st_label (label);
	  if (n != MATCH_YES)
	    {
	      m = n;
	      goto not_yes;
	    }
 
	  matches++;
	  goto loop;
 
	case 'o':
	  ip = va_arg (argp, int *);
	  n = gfc_match_intrinsic_op ((gfc_intrinsic_op *) ip);
	  if (n != MATCH_YES)
	    {
	      m = n;
	      goto not_yes;
	    }
 
	  matches++;
	  goto loop;
 
	case 't':
	  if (gfc_match_eos () != MATCH_YES)
	    {
	      m = MATCH_NO;
	      goto not_yes;
	    }
	  goto loop;
 
	case ' ':
	  if (gfc_match_space () == MATCH_YES)
	    goto loop;
	  m = MATCH_NO;
	  goto not_yes;
 
	case '%':
	  break;	/* Fall through to character matcher.  */
 
	default:
	  gfc_internal_error ("gfc_match(): Bad match code %c", c);
	}
 
    default:
 
      /* gfc_next_ascii_char converts characters to lower-case, so we shouldn't
	 expect an upper case character here!  */
      gcc_assert (TOLOWER (c) == c);
 
      if (c == gfc_next_ascii_char ())
	goto loop;
      break;
    }
 
not_yes:
  va_end (argp);
 
  if (m != MATCH_YES)
    {
      /* Clean up after a failed match.  */
      gfc_current_locus = old_loc;
      va_start (argp, target);
 
      p = target;
      for (; matches > 0; matches--)
	{
	  while (*p++ != '%');
 
	  switch (*p++)
	    {
	    case '%':
	      matches++;
	      break;		/* Skip.  */
 
	    /* Matches that don't have to be undone */
	    case 'o':
	    case 'l':
	    case 'n':
	    case 's':
	      (void) va_arg (argp, void **);
	      break;
 
	    case 'e':
	    case 'v':
	      vp = va_arg (argp, void **);
	      gfc_free_expr ((struct gfc_expr *)*vp);
	      *vp = NULL;
	      break;
	    }
	}
 
      va_end (argp);
    }
 
  return m;
}

/* The IF statement is a bit of a pain.  First of all, there are three
   forms of it, the simple IF, the IF that starts a block and the
   arithmetic IF.
 
   There is a problem with the simple IF and that is the fact that we
   only have a single level of undo information on symbols.  What this
   means is for a simple IF, we must re-match the whole IF statement
   multiple times in order to guarantee that the symbol table ends up
   in the proper state.  */
 
static match match_simple_forall (void);
static match match_simple_where (void);
 
match
gfc_match_if (gfc_statement *if_type)
{
  gfc_expr *expr;
  gfc_st_label *l1, *l2, *l3;
  locus old_loc, old_loc2;
  gfc_code *p;
  match m, n;
 
  n = gfc_match_label ();
  if (n == MATCH_ERROR)
    return n;
 
  old_loc = gfc_current_locus;
 
  m = gfc_match (" if ( %e", &expr);
  if (m != MATCH_YES)
    return m;
 
  old_loc2 = gfc_current_locus;
  gfc_current_locus = old_loc;
 
  if (gfc_match_parens () == MATCH_ERROR)
    return MATCH_ERROR;
 
  gfc_current_locus = old_loc2;
 
  if (gfc_match_char (')') != MATCH_YES)
    {
      gfc_error ("Syntax error in IF-expression at %C");
      gfc_free_expr (expr);
      return MATCH_ERROR;
    }
 
  m = gfc_match (" %l , %l , %l%t", &l1, &l2, &l3);
 
  if (m == MATCH_YES)
    {
      if (n == MATCH_YES)
	{
	  gfc_error ("Block label not appropriate for arithmetic IF "
		     "statement at %C");
	  gfc_free_expr (expr);
	  return MATCH_ERROR;
	}
 
      if (gfc_reference_st_label (l1, ST_LABEL_TARGET) == FAILURE
	  || gfc_reference_st_label (l2, ST_LABEL_TARGET) == FAILURE
	  || gfc_reference_st_label (l3, ST_LABEL_TARGET) == FAILURE)
	{
	  gfc_free_expr (expr);
	  return MATCH_ERROR;
	}
 
      if (gfc_notify_std (GFC_STD_F95_OBS, "Obsolescent feature: Arithmetic IF "
			  "statement at %C") == FAILURE)
	return MATCH_ERROR;
 
      new_st.op = EXEC_ARITHMETIC_IF;
      new_st.expr1 = expr;
      new_st.label1 = l1;
      new_st.label2 = l2;
      new_st.label3 = l3;
 
      *if_type = ST_ARITHMETIC_IF;
      return MATCH_YES;
    }
 
  if (gfc_match (" then%t") == MATCH_YES)
    {
      new_st.op = EXEC_IF;
      new_st.expr1 = expr;
      *if_type = ST_IF_BLOCK;
      return MATCH_YES;
    }
 
  if (n == MATCH_YES)
    {
      gfc_error ("Block label is not appropriate for IF statement at %C");
      gfc_free_expr (expr);
      return MATCH_ERROR;
    }
 
  /* At this point the only thing left is a simple IF statement.  At
     this point, n has to be MATCH_NO, so we don't have to worry about
     re-matching a block label.  From what we've got so far, try
     matching an assignment.  */
 
  *if_type = ST_SIMPLE_IF;
 
  m = gfc_match_assignment ();
  if (m == MATCH_YES)
    goto got_match;
 
  gfc_free_expr (expr);
  gfc_undo_symbols ();
  gfc_current_locus = old_loc;
 
  /* m can be MATCH_NO or MATCH_ERROR, here.  For MATCH_ERROR, a mangled
     assignment was found.  For MATCH_NO, continue to call the various
     matchers.  */
  if (m == MATCH_ERROR)
    return MATCH_ERROR;
 
  gfc_match (" if ( %e ) ", &expr);	/* Guaranteed to match.  */
 
  m = gfc_match_pointer_assignment ();
  if (m == MATCH_YES)
    goto got_match;
 
  gfc_free_expr (expr);
  gfc_undo_symbols ();
  gfc_current_locus = old_loc;
 
  gfc_match (" if ( %e ) ", &expr);	/* Guaranteed to match.  */
 
  /* Look at the next keyword to see which matcher to call.  Matching
     the keyword doesn't affect the symbol table, so we don't have to
     restore between tries.  */
 
#define match(string, subr, statement) \
  if (gfc_match(string) == MATCH_YES) { m = subr(); goto got_match; }
 
  gfc_clear_error ();
 
  match ("allocate", gfc_match_allocate, ST_ALLOCATE)
  match ("assign", gfc_match_assign, ST_LABEL_ASSIGNMENT)
  match ("backspace", gfc_match_backspace, ST_BACKSPACE)
  match ("call", gfc_match_call, ST_CALL)
  match ("close", gfc_match_close, ST_CLOSE)
  match ("continue", gfc_match_continue, ST_CONTINUE)
  match ("cycle", gfc_match_cycle, ST_CYCLE)
  match ("deallocate", gfc_match_deallocate, ST_DEALLOCATE)
  match ("end file", gfc_match_endfile, ST_END_FILE)
  match ("exit", gfc_match_exit, ST_EXIT)
  match ("flush", gfc_match_flush, ST_FLUSH)
  match ("forall", match_simple_forall, ST_FORALL)
  match ("go to", gfc_match_goto, ST_GOTO)
  match ("if", match_arithmetic_if, ST_ARITHMETIC_IF)
  match ("inquire", gfc_match_inquire, ST_INQUIRE)
  match ("nullify", gfc_match_nullify, ST_NULLIFY)
  match ("open", gfc_match_open, ST_OPEN)
  match ("pause", gfc_match_pause, ST_NONE)
  match ("print", gfc_match_print, ST_WRITE)
  match ("read", gfc_match_read, ST_READ)
  match ("return", gfc_match_return, ST_RETURN)
  match ("rewind", gfc_match_rewind, ST_REWIND)
  match ("stop", gfc_match_stop, ST_STOP)
  match ("wait", gfc_match_wait, ST_WAIT)
  match ("where", match_simple_where, ST_WHERE)
  match ("write", gfc_match_write, ST_WRITE)
 
  /* The gfc_match_assignment() above may have returned a MATCH_NO
     where the assignment was to a named constant.  Check that 
     special case here.  */
  m = gfc_match_assignment ();
  if (m == MATCH_NO)
   {
      gfc_error ("Cannot assign to a named constant at %C");
      gfc_free_expr (expr);
      gfc_undo_symbols ();
      gfc_current_locus = old_loc;
      return MATCH_ERROR;
   }
 
  /* All else has failed, so give up.  See if any of the matchers has
     stored an error message of some sort.  */
  if (gfc_error_check () == 0)
    gfc_error ("Unclassifiable statement in IF-clause at %C");
 
  gfc_free_expr (expr);
  return MATCH_ERROR;
 
got_match:
  if (m == MATCH_NO)
    gfc_error ("Syntax error in IF-clause at %C");
  if (m != MATCH_YES)
    {
      gfc_free_expr (expr);
      return MATCH_ERROR;
    }
 
  /* At this point, we've matched the single IF and the action clause
     is in new_st.  Rearrange things so that the IF statement appears
     in new_st.  */
 
  p = gfc_get_code ();
  p->next = gfc_get_code ();
  *p->next = new_st;
  p->next->loc = gfc_current_locus;
 
  p->expr1 = expr;
  p->op = EXEC_IF;
 
  gfc_clear_new_st ();
 
  new_st.op = EXEC_IF;
  new_st.block = p;
 
  return MATCH_YES;
}
 
#undef match

/* Match the GO TO statement.  As a computed GOTO statement is
   matched, it is transformed into an equivalent SELECT block.  No
   tree is necessary, and the resulting jumps-to-jumps are
   specifically optimized away by the back end.  */
 
match
gfc_match_goto (void)
{
  gfc_code *head, *tail;
  gfc_expr *expr;
  gfc_case *cp;
  gfc_st_label *label;
  int i;
  match m;
 
  if (gfc_match (" %l%t", &label) == MATCH_YES)
    {
      if (gfc_reference_st_label (label, ST_LABEL_TARGET) == FAILURE)
	return MATCH_ERROR;
 
      new_st.op = EXEC_GOTO;
      new_st.label1 = label;
      return MATCH_YES;
    }
 
  /* The assigned GO TO statement.  */ 
 
  if (gfc_match_variable (&expr, 0) == MATCH_YES)
    {
      if (gfc_notify_std (GFC_STD_F95_DEL, "Deleted feature: Assigned GOTO "
			  "statement at %C")
	  == FAILURE)
	return MATCH_ERROR;
 
      new_st.op = EXEC_GOTO;
      new_st.expr1 = expr;
 
      if (gfc_match_eos () == MATCH_YES)
	return MATCH_YES;
 
      /* Match label list.  */
      gfc_match_char (',');
      if (gfc_match_char ('(') != MATCH_YES)
	{
	  gfc_syntax_error (ST_GOTO);
	  return MATCH_ERROR;
	}
      head = tail = NULL;
 
      do
	{
	  m = gfc_match_st_label (&label);
	  if (m != MATCH_YES)
	    goto syntax;
 
	  if (gfc_reference_st_label (label, ST_LABEL_TARGET) == FAILURE)
	    goto cleanup;
 
	  if (head == NULL)
	    head = tail = gfc_get_code ();
	  else
	    {
	      tail->block = gfc_get_code ();
	      tail = tail->block;
	    }
 
	  tail->label1 = label;
	  tail->op = EXEC_GOTO;
	}
      while (gfc_match_char (',') == MATCH_YES);
 
      if (gfc_match (")%t") != MATCH_YES)
	goto syntax;
 
      if (head == NULL)
	{
	   gfc_error ("Statement label list in GOTO at %C cannot be empty");
	   goto syntax;
	}
      new_st.block = head;
 
      return MATCH_YES;
    }
 
  /* Last chance is a computed GO TO statement.  */
  if (gfc_match_char ('(') != MATCH_YES)
    {
      gfc_syntax_error (ST_GOTO);
      return MATCH_ERROR;
    }
 
  head = tail = NULL;
  i = 1;
 
  do
    {
      m = gfc_match_st_label (&label);
      if (m != MATCH_YES)
	goto syntax;
 
      if (gfc_reference_st_label (label, ST_LABEL_TARGET) == FAILURE)
	goto cleanup;
 
      if (head == NULL)
	head = tail = gfc_get_code ();
      else
	{
	  tail->block = gfc_get_code ();
	  tail = tail->block;
	}
 
      cp = gfc_get_case ();
      cp->low = cp->high = gfc_int_expr (i++);
 
      tail->op = EXEC_SELECT;
      tail->ext.case_list = cp;
 
      tail->next = gfc_get_code ();
      tail->next->op = EXEC_GOTO;
      tail->next->label1 = label;
    }
  while (gfc_match_char (',') == MATCH_YES);
 
  if (gfc_match_char (')') != MATCH_YES)
    goto syntax;
 
  if (head == NULL)
    {
      gfc_error ("Statement label list in GOTO at %C cannot be empty");
      goto syntax;
    }
 
  /* Get the rest of the statement.  */
  gfc_match_char (',');
 
  if (gfc_match (" %e%t", &expr) != MATCH_YES)
    goto syntax;
 
  if (gfc_notify_std (GFC_STD_F95_OBS, "Obsolescent feature: Computed GOTO "
		      "at %C") == FAILURE)
    return MATCH_ERROR;
 
  /* At this point, a computed GOTO has been fully matched and an
     equivalent SELECT statement constructed.  */
 
  new_st.op = EXEC_SELECT;
  new_st.expr1 = NULL;
 
  /* Hack: For a "real" SELECT, the expression is in expr. We put
     it in expr2 so we can distinguish then and produce the correct
     diagnostics.  */
  new_st.expr2 = expr;
  new_st.block = head;
  return MATCH_YES;
 
syntax:
  gfc_syntax_error (ST_GOTO);
cleanup:
  gfc_free_statements (head);
  return MATCH_ERROR;
}

/* Match a CALL statement.  The tricky part here are possible
   alternate return specifiers.  We handle these by having all
   "subroutines" actually return an integer via a register that gives
   the return number.  If the call specifies alternate returns, we
   generate code for a SELECT statement whose case clauses contain
   GOTOs to the various labels.  */
 
match
gfc_match_call (void)
{
  char name[GFC_MAX_SYMBOL_LEN + 1];
  gfc_actual_arglist *a, *arglist;
  gfc_case *new_case;
  gfc_symbol *sym;
  gfc_symtree *st;
  gfc_code *c;
  match m;
  int i;
 
  arglist = NULL;
 
  m = gfc_match ("% %n", name);
  if (m == MATCH_NO)
    goto syntax;
  if (m != MATCH_YES)
    return m;
 
  if (gfc_get_ha_sym_tree (name, &st))
    return MATCH_ERROR;
 
  sym = st->n.sym;
 
  /* If this is a variable of derived-type, it probably starts a type-bound
     procedure call.  */
  if ((sym->attr.flavor != FL_PROCEDURE
       || gfc_is_function_return_value (sym, gfc_current_ns))
      && (sym->ts.type == BT_DERIVED || sym->ts.type == BT_CLASS))
    return match_typebound_call (st);
 
  /* If it does not seem to be callable (include functions so that the
     right association is made.  They are thrown out in resolution.)
     ...  */
  if (!sym->attr.generic
	&& !sym->attr.subroutine
	&& !sym->attr.function)
    {
      if (!(sym->attr.external && !sym->attr.referenced))
	{
	  /* ...create a symbol in this scope...  */
	  if (sym->ns != gfc_current_ns
	        && gfc_get_sym_tree (name, NULL, &st, false) == 1)
            return MATCH_ERROR;
 
	  if (sym != st->n.sym)
	    sym = st->n.sym;
	}
 
      /* ...and then to try to make the symbol into a subroutine.  */
      if (gfc_add_subroutine (&sym->attr, sym->name, NULL) == FAILURE)
	return MATCH_ERROR;
    }
 
  gfc_set_sym_referenced (sym);
 
  if (gfc_match_eos () != MATCH_YES)
    {
      m = gfc_match_actual_arglist (1, &arglist);
      if (m == MATCH_NO)
	goto syntax;
      if (m == MATCH_ERROR)
	goto cleanup;
 
      if (gfc_match_eos () != MATCH_YES)
	goto syntax;
    }
 
  /* If any alternate return labels were found, construct a SELECT
     statement that will jump to the right place.  */
 
  i = 0;
  for (a = arglist; a; a = a->next)
    if (a->expr == NULL)
      i = 1;
 
  if (i)
    {
      gfc_symtree *select_st;
      gfc_symbol *select_sym;
      char name[GFC_MAX_SYMBOL_LEN + 1];
 
      new_st.next = c = gfc_get_code ();
      c->op = EXEC_SELECT;
      sprintf (name, "_result_%s", sym->name);
      gfc_get_ha_sym_tree (name, &select_st);   /* Can't fail.  */
 
      select_sym = select_st->n.sym;
      select_sym->ts.type = BT_INTEGER;
      select_sym->ts.kind = gfc_default_integer_kind;
      gfc_set_sym_referenced (select_sym);
      c->expr1 = gfc_get_expr ();
      c->expr1->expr_type = EXPR_VARIABLE;
      c->expr1->symtree = select_st;
      c->expr1->ts = select_sym->ts;
      c->expr1->where = gfc_current_locus;
 
      i = 0;
      for (a = arglist; a; a = a->next)
	{
	  if (a->expr != NULL)
	    continue;
 
	  if (gfc_reference_st_label (a->label, ST_LABEL_TARGET) == FAILURE)
	    continue;
 
	  i++;
 
	  c->block = gfc_get_code ();
	  c = c->block;
	  c->op = EXEC_SELECT;
 
	  new_case = gfc_get_case ();
	  new_case->high = new_case->low = gfc_int_expr (i);
	  c->ext.case_list = new_case;
 
	  c->next = gfc_get_code ();
	  c->next->op = EXEC_GOTO;
	  c->next->label1 = a->label;
	}
    }
 
  new_st.op = EXEC_CALL;
  new_st.symtree = st;
  new_st.ext.actual = arglist;
 
  return MATCH_YES;
 
syntax:
  gfc_syntax_error (ST_CALL);
 
cleanup:
  gfc_free_actual_arglist (arglist);
  return MATCH_ERROR;
}
